Genma Ship Loader Ready to Balikpapan Coal Terminal (BCT)
Balikpapan Coal Terminal (BCT) is the largest coal terminals in Indonesia located in Balikpapan, East Kalimantan. BCT is managed by PT Dermaga Perkasa Pratama, the subsidiary of PT Bayan Resources Tbk, and equipped with ship loading and unloading berths.
BCT has a handling throughput capacity of 15.0 million tons per annum and a stockpiling capacity of approximately one million tons across 16 stockpiles. It is also able to serve handy, panamax and capesize vessels. BCT also has a loading facility with capacity of 4,000 tons per hour, enabling it to load a Panamax size vessel in one day.
Other than that, BCT also has unloading facility with 5,000 tons per hour capacity and is able to unload coal from 2 barges simultaneously. BCT is facilitated to mix coals from 4 stockpiles with computerized system to meet customer specifications.
Even though, BCT still requires a ship loader to satisfy the increasing loading demand.
Tailor-Made Solution to Help Customer Handle More Cargo
Based on customer’s operation and environmental demand, Genma designed the ship loader with following parameters:
Handling material: coal
Capacity: 4000TPH
Weight: 270T
Applicable vessel: 15000DWT - 120000DWT
